On September 5-11, 2016, nine persons fell victim to armed conflict in Northern Caucasus

During the week of September 5-11, 2016, nine persons fell victim to the armed conflict in Northern Caucasus. Of them, eight persons were killed, one more man was wounded. These are the results of the calculations run by the "Caucasian Knot" based on its own materials and information from other open sources.

The death toll includes seven suspected members of the armed underground in Dagestan. Besides, it was also reported about the death of one civilian in Dagestan.

Special and counterterrorist operations

On September 5, one more shootout took place in the forest near the village of Samur of the Magaramkent District in Dagestan, where the counterterrorist (CTO) legal regime was introduced on September 4 and where a special operation was held. In the first half of the day, in the Samur forest, law enforcers killed an armed man, who opened fire on them and was killed in a shootout. Besides, the law enforcement bodies have succeeded in proving that the killed suspects were involved in the death of a Samur resident, who "a month ago" went into the forest with a saw to collect firewood, and later was killed by unidentified attackers. The saw of the man was found in a camp of the killed militants. On September 9, in the Samur forest, unidentified men opened fire on fighters of the federal forces. During the armed clash, a fighter of the Dagestani OMON (riot police) was wounded.

At 6:00 a.m. Moscow time of September 7, the CTO legal regime was introduced in the Dagestani town of Izberbash. Law enforcers cordoned off the house, which, according to them, might be hiding members of illegal armed formations (IAFs) involved in an attack on policemen committed in this August. People from nearby houses were evacuated. As a result of the armed clash, three militants were killed. In the course of the special operation in Izberbash, Magomed Khalimbekov, Rinat Osmanov, and Bagaudin Magomedov were killed. The CTO legal regime introduced in the morning was lifted at 7:00 p.m.

At 6:00 a.m. of September 7, in Rakhmatullaev Street, law enforcers cordoned off the house, where, according to the preliminary information, members of the armed underground were hiding. At 7:00 a.m. Moscow time, the CTO legal regime was introduced in the Kirov District of Makhachkala. The cordoned off militants refused to lay down their arms and opened fire on the law enforcers, who then began storming the house. Three militants were killed by the following armed clash. As a result of the shootout in Makhachkala, Rashid Umakhanov, Amalatbek Bogatyrov, and Nazir Kasumov were killed. The CTO legal regime introduced in the morning was lifted at 7:00 p.m.

Detentions

On September 9, in the Dagestani town of Izberbash, staff members of the Ministry of Internal Affairs (MIA) detained a member of the armed underground. The detainee is suspected of killing a policeman and a local resident, committed in July 2016. The 20-year-old man had a pistol, two magazines and several dozen rounds of ammunition for the pistol, and a handheld transceiver in his pockets.
